Perupetro completes complementary measures for hydrocarbon activities in Tumbes

Bnamericas

From Perupetro

Between June 2018 and February 2019, PERUPETRO S.A, within the framework of its responsibilities, finished implementing complementary measures to strengthen the process of citizen participation in hydrocarbon activities in Tumbes, in order to ensure access to information in all social actors.

The complementary measures included a process of mapping, raising concerns and needs, rapprochement and sensitization with about 1,000 residents and sectoral, regional and local authorities in Tumbes, including fishing associations, other grassroots associations and the general public.

PERUPETRO S.A. currently has an active presence in the fishing harbors where fishermen carry out their daily work with the intention of maintaining open channels of communication. It has also been holding meetings with authorities from the regional government of Tumbes, as well as provincial and district mayors and the general public.

From the various meetings held, a set of basic demands was identified that require the attention of various sectors, such as basic sanitation, safety, productive capacities and infrastructure, health and education, among others.

PERUPETRO channeled the diverse demands of the population to the responsible sectors of the state, so that they could be addressed. To this end, meetings were held with PCM, MINEM, PRODUCE, MVCS, MINAGRI, MINSA, MINEDU, OEFA and OSINERGMIN, among others.

On January 5, 2019, the Ministry of Energy and Mines published the New Regulations for Citizen Participation in Hydrocarbon Activities, aimed at strengthening the rights of access to information and citizen participation.

With this new regulation, on February 2 of this year, PERUPETRO held complementary face-to-face Citizen Participation events in Tumbes for Lot Z-64, which included the participation of more than 500 people, including authorities and the public.

Following the results of the implementation of the complementary measures in Tumbes, the MINEM, through from the Vice Ministry of Hydrocarbons and PERUPETRO, proposed a work plan to meet the urgent needs identified.

This plan contemplates a mechanism of permanent intersectoral articulation installed in Tumbes that accelerates the execution of public investment projects (PIPs) and which, through the appropriate allocation of the economic resources generated by the royalties, shall ensure that the projects are implemented to close the identified gaps in development.

The Tumbes region received more than 1.5bn soles from oil royalties in the last 10 years. In the last three years alone, the region received 332mn soles that, according to the law, must be directed to infrastructure projects for the benefit of the population.
